ASP(Active Server Pages)是一种由Microsoft开发的服务器端脚本引擎,主要用于创建动态交互式网页。它基于使用VBScript(Visual Basic Scripting Edition)或JScript作为脚本语言的技术。ASP可以实现数据库连接、表单处理、用户认证等功能,是广泛用于构建企业级网站和Web应用程序的技术。
PHP简介
PHP(PHP: Hypertext Preprocessor)是一种流行的开源服务器端脚本语言,最初是为Web开发而设计。PHP脚本在服务器上执行,生成返回给客户端浏览器,实现动态网页的构建。与ASP相比,PHP更加灵活,支持多种数据库连接和操作,还可以与HTML混编,使得开发人员可以更加高效地构建Web应用。
- ASP与PHP的对比
- ASP是Microsoft开发的技术,依赖于Windows服务器环境,而PHP是跨平台的开源技术,可在多种操作系统上运行。
- ASP使用VBScript或JScript,而PHP使用自身的语法,更易于学习和使用。
- PHP社区庞大活跃,拥有大量开源库和框架,为开发者提供了丰富的资源。
GSP中文
Groovy Server Pages(GSP)是一种为Groovy编程语言开发的服务器端技术,它提供了与JavaServer Pages(JSP)类似的功能和语法,但更加优雅和简洁。GSP中文的意思是Groovy服务器页面中文版,主要用于开发基于Groovy的Web应用程序。
GSP中文与JSP一样,可以嵌入Java代码,并与后端Java代码实现数据交互和逻辑处理。同时,GSP中文还支持Groovy语法糖,如闭包、DSL等特性,使得开发更加轻松愉快。
结论
无论是使用ASP、PHP还是GSP中文,都可以根据项目需求和个人技术偏好选择合适的技术进行Web开发。ASP适合Windows平台,PHP适用于跨平台开发,而GSP中文则提供了Groovy语法特性,让开发者可以更加便捷地构建优秀的Web应用程序。
希望通过本文介绍,读者对ASP、PHP和GSP中文有了更深入的了解,为今后的项目选择和开发提供参考和帮助。
- 相关评论
- 我要评论
-